Dimethyldibenzylidene Sorbitol is also known as D-Glucitol, 1,3- 2,4-diacetal with 3,4-dimethylbenzaldehyde.
Dimethyldibenzylidene Sorbitol is a synthetic acetal derived from sorbitol and 3,4-dimethylbenzaldehyde, used as a gelling and clarifying agent in cosmetic formulations.
